WRITERS' BLOCK A
Plot, Structure, Character, and Dialogue are explored in Writers' Block A, one of Playwrights Theatre Centre's most popular and longest running programs. Block A is a basic class for beginning playwrights. The goal of the program is to hone the playwrights' abilities by isolating and focusing on the fundamentals of playwriting through discussion, critiques, and writing exercises.

WHEN: One evening a week throughout Sept, Oct, Nov, and Dec. Please check our "News" section for application deadlines in late summer.

WRITERS' BLOCK M
This popular program explores the art and technique of writing monologues and plays for solo performers. Led by award-winning poet and playwright Aaron Bushkowsky, participants meet one day a week for six weeks in the summer. The program divides time equally between writing exercises, criticism, and discussion. The emphasis is on helping playwrights emerge with an improved solo script and a deeper understanding of the monologue.

WHEN: One evening a week between June and August.

THE NEWS
A launching pad for young playwrights, The News is a unique commissioned program and event within the Vancouver New Play Festival. Representing our commitment to young playwrights with new visions of the contemporary world, PTC annually commissions one-act plays from two exceptional early career playwrights. The playwrights are challenged to write timely, daring, and engaged plays that reflect the reality of living in the world at this particular time

WHEN: Part of the Vancouver New Play Festival.
SUBMISSION GUIDELINES: By directed search. Playwrights must be under 30 years of age.

THE PTC COLONY
The PTC Colony is an annual play development intensive. We provide a group of playwrights-in-residence with a dedicated creative context, dramaturgical resources and a company of actors to read their new plays at intervals throughout the colony. The focus is on the individual development of each playwright's work as well as the creation of a supportive and productive community of playwrights, directors, dramaturgs and actors.

WHEN: November
